Job Description

TPF Recruitment is thrilled to collaborate with an esteemed independent accountancy practice in Forest Row seeking a Qualified Accountant to become an integral part of their closeknit and dynamic team. This wellestablished firm comprising around 15 dedicated professionals is renowned for its positive culture prioritising staff wellbeing and exceptional client care. With an impressive staff retention rate the firm offers a supportive environment that champions a healthy worklife balance.

As a Qualified Accountant your role will be pivotal in supporting the firm s success and managing a diverse portfolio of clients. Your responsibilities will include:
  • Client Management: Build and maintain robust relationships with clients serving as their primary contact for financial and business advice.
  • Accounts Preparation: Prepare yearend accounts for sole traders partnerships and limited companies in accordance with accounting standards.
  • Taxation: Oversee corporation tax VAT and personal tax compliance while offering ad hoc tax planning advice.
  • Audit and Assurance: Support statutory audit work as required.
  • Management Accounts: Prepare monthly or quarterly management accounts providing analysis to aid clients in making informed decisions.
  • Supervision and Training: Mentor junior staff aiding their professional development.
  • Compliance: Ensure all work aligns with regulatory requirements and deadlines.
  • Business Development: Identify new service opportunities or referrals contributing to the firm s growth initiatives.


Requirements

To excel in this role you should possess:
  • A professional accountancy qualification (ACA ACCA or equivalent).
  • Prior experience within an accountancy practice.
  • Strong technical skills in accounts preparation tax and ideally audit.
  • Excellent communication skills and a clientfocused approach.
  • The ability to manage multiple priorities and work efficiently under deadlines.
